Output 61d4adb3212fc690865874cc850cb3bcb207c6dda904856c9c6aebe857e1d379:0

value
1467900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81af71dfe17cba7990710643417ddebfe49c8b4 OP_EQUAL
address
3MPgBZVqJn5JGpEit5a2RfhrYJiuHgGy7s
transaction
61d4adb3212fc690865874cc850cb3bcb207c6dda904856c9c6aebe857e1d379
confirmations
88111
spent
true